The new year marks the beginning of a crucial stretch for the U.S. women’s youth national teams.
The 2024 edition of the Under-17 Women’s World Cup is set for October of this year in the Dominican Republic.
This year’s qualifying tournament will be held in Mexico, kicking off on February 1. With a Concacaf nation hosting it, only two teams from the region will qualify – leaving the United States with a smaller margin for error.
A final U.S. camp is set to take place this week, beginning on January 3 in California. The top 07s in the country have been summoned, looking to make a case for a roster spot. Several players have been involved since the 2022 edition of the U15 Concacaf Championship, looking to maintain a spot and help the U.S. reach the World Cup.
